blacktree-quicksilver - issue #323

Command Window with Selection does not work


Posted on Feb 11, 2010 by Swift Bear

What steps will reproduce the problem? 1. Enable "Command Window with Selection" Quicksilver trigger in preferences 2. Use the trigger (Shift+Ctrl+Space) 3.

What is the expected output? What do you see instead?

The selected file/folder should appear in the left side of quicksilver bezel when trigger is activated. But instead the left side is blank and the right side shows the "Type to Search" icon.

What version of the product (including Quicksilver version, AND the module version related to the buggy functionality if appropriate) are you using? On what operating system?

Quicksilver B56a7 (3839) Mac OS X 10.6.2 Please provide any additional information below, and please attach the corresponding crash log under ~/Library/Logs/CrashReporter if your problem ends this way.

Comment #11

Posted on Sep 4, 2011 by Quick Wombat

You need to enable the quicksilver internal commands in the catalog for this trigger to work.
